For a pressure sensor of the same class with a ceramic diaphragm, use PMC11. If the pressure range exceeds 4MPa or explosion protection is required, use PMP21 / PMC21. For hygienic applications, use PMP23.

The Cerabar PMP11 is the most economical compact pressure transmitter. It uses a piezoresistive sensor with a gauge pressure measuring range of 400 mbar..40bar. The PMP11 uses high-quality materials (e.g. 316L) and meets the measurement conditions in the process industry. It can be used in standard applications in the process industry.

 

Advantages

Ultra-compact design and user-configurable measuring range for simple, time-saving installation and setup in the plant

Reference measuring accuracy of 0.5% with high long-term stability and high repeatability, ensuring high-quality process monitoring in standard processes

Strict use of 316L material and passing all tests during production guarantee wide process compatibility

 

Application areas

Pressure transmitter with a fully welded metal sensor for gauge pressure measurement of gases or liquids.

Process connection: thread

Process temperature: -25...+85°C (-13...+185°F)

Process pressure: 400 mbar...+40 bar (6...600 psi)

Measuring accuracy: ±0.5% of full scale
